What that >>> means is that the visible sysfs attributes don't get added, but >>> otherwise the rphy is fully functional as far as the driver sees it, so >>> this condition doesn't have to be a fatal error which kills the device. >>> >>> There are two ways of handling this: >>> >>>     1. The above to move the condition from an ignored to a fatal >>> error. >>>        It's so rare that we almost never see it in practice and if it >>>        ever happened, the machine is so low on memory that something >>>        else is bound to fail an allocation and kill the device anyway, >>>        so treating it as non-fatal likely serves no purpose. >>>     2. Simply to make the assumption that transport_remove_device() is >>>        idempotent true by adding a flag in the internal_class to >>> signify >>>        removal is required. This would preserve current behaviour and >>>        have the bonus that it only requires a single patch, not one >>>        patch per transport class object that has this problem. >>> >>> I'd probably prefer 2. since it's way less work, but others might have >>> different opinions. >> Current some callers ignore the return value of >> transport_add_device(), if it fails, >> it will cause null-ptr-deref in transport_remove_device(). >> >> James suggested that add some check in transport_remove_device(), so >> all can >> be fix in one patch. >> >> Do you have any suggestion for this ? > > Personally I prefer 1.
